About Supreme Cannabis (TSE:FIRE) Stock

The Supreme Cannabis Company, Inc. engages in the production of medical cannabis products in Canada. The company was formerly known as Supreme Pharmaceuticals Inc. and changed its name to The Supreme Cannabis Company, Inc. in December 2017. The Supreme Cannabis Company, Inc. was incorporated in 1979 and is headquartered in Toronto, Canada.
